About Acorn

Acorn is an in-home care registry serving seniors and other clients in Chapel Hill, North Carolina, and throughout the Triangle region including Durham, Raleigh, and surrounding areas in Chatham, Orange, and Durham counties. The company refers screened, qualified caregivers to clients' homes rather than operating a facility-based community.

Acorn identifies caregivers through a meticulous multi-step process that includes detailed interviews, national criminal background checks, driving records, sex offender registry verification, and checks against other state and national databases. The company serves seniors, those recovering from surgery, new and expectant mothers, and other individuals requiring care support at home.

Founded and operated by Lorenzo Mejia and Mary Lynn, the owners emphasize responsiveness to client concerns and commit to addressing issues when they arise. The company reports receiving well over 100 five-star reviews from clients. In 2014, Mejia was named Dementia Care Professional of the Year in the United States by the Alzheimer's Foundation of America, and he received recognition from the Orange County Board of Commissioners for service to the elder community and advocacy for people with dementia.
